A few years ago I was driving into Aylesbury from Waddesdon and, where the road dips to go under a railway bridge, I saw a Land Rover and livestock trailer upside down on the grass verge.

The driver, a farmer, had exited the vehicle and was unhurt although somewhat shaken and two Border Collies were running about.

I assumed that the trailer was loaded with sheep and feared the worst. It turned out that it was loaded with a considerable weight of concrete blocks.

I asked the driver if the tail 'had started wagging the dog'. No prizes for guessing the answer.
